A Note on Pricing
Estate cleanouts are usually priced as a full load, since they typically cover an entire property — most run $600 to $850 or more, depending on the home's size and how much is inside.
You'll get a firm number after a walkthrough, before any work starts. If the estate involves significant accumulation or a more complex sorting process, we'll talk through that upfront too.
